The organization, founded by the investor and philanthropist George Soros, focuses on building democratic and inclusive societies around the world. African Development and Health In Africa, the Open Society Foundations have concentrated heavily on public health crises, notably contributing to the fight against HIV/AIDS and supporting broader healthcare access.
Furthermore, substantial funding flows into Africa to support public health, educational reform, and efforts to strengthen local governance structures.
